What exactly is a load stress test used on an online casino function?

A load stress test simulates a massive number of users visiting a website or app simultaneously. It stresses the platform’s servers and software to their limits to find breaking points, evaluate slowdowns, and confirm stability during actual peak traffic. In New Zealand, this could be during a major sports final.
